Ron Sherry Talks DN Ice Boating: A 6 Part Series
PART 1 of 6
Growing up ice boating, sailing skimmers with his three children, regatta preparation, regatta nerves, describing the "perfect start" to an ice boat race.
Watch video in new window.
PART 2 of 6
The "perfect start", continued, North American vs. European starts, gullwing plank composition & deflection, "you must make the plank like a tree", plank and mast working together, mast, light air sailing, runner preparation, laser light device for straight edges, not working on runners while they are too hot.
Watch video in new window.
PART 3 OF 6
Runners, using string gauge to ensure runners parallel to each other and perpendicular to boat, using a hound-to-base mast template, ensuring runners are tight in front and back of chock, why the most important time for runner alignment is downwind, deciding which runners to use, making runners dull in front & back & sharp in middle, minimum t-runners, pivot point.
Watch video in new window.
PART 4 of 6
Sails, training regimen, side and head stay discussion, boom position, mast rotation, plank position.
